Condivisione file con NFS

5 Gennaio 2008

Se dovete condividere file all’interno di una rete mista (Linux e/o Windows e/o Mac) dovete installare e configurare Samba.

Se invece dovete condividere file all’interno di una rete unificata Linux (solo pc con Linux), o se siete in rete mista ma la condivisione dovrà servire solo i pc Linux, vi converrà usare NFS in quanto più sicuro, performante e leggero.

Lato server

Installiamo i servizi NFS:

sudo apt-get install portmap nfs-kernel-server

Leggi il seguito di questo post »


Creare il proprio server DNS “casalingo” in Ubuntu, Debian, o NSLU2 Debian con BIND9

4 Gennaio 2008

Installiamo Bind9:

sudo apt-get update

sudo apt-get install bind9

Facciamo una copia di backup dei file di configurazione:

sudo cp -p /etc/named.conf.options /etc/named.conf.options.originale

sudo cp -p /etc/named.conf.local /etc/named.conf.local.originale

Modifichiamo il file name.conf.options:

sudo nano /etc/named.conf.options

Leggi il seguito di questo post »


Eseguire i comandi principali anche fuori da /opt/bin in NSLU2 Unslung 6.x

30 Dicembre 2007

Questo doveva essere possibile anche di predefinito, ma a quanto pare se lo sono scordati. Almeno per quanto riguarda il firmware UNSLUNG 6.8

Basta integrare la variabile d’amiente $PATH con il seguente comando:

export PATH=$PATH:/opt/bin

Il comando va ridato ogni volta che si riavvia l’NSLU2.


Installare editor Nano nell’NSLU2 con firmware Unslung

30 Dicembre 2007

A mio avviso, Nano, è un editor molto più user-friendly del preinstallato vi.

Nel firmware Unslung non è installato di default ma possiamo installarlo così:

ipkg install nano

Adesso, per farlo funzionare correttamente dobbiamo impostare due variabili d’ambiente (environment variables):

export TERMINFO=/opt/share/terminfo

export TERM=vt100

Purtroppo, ogni volta che riavvieremo l’NSLU2, queste due variabili d’ambiente andranno reimpostate.


Montare una cartella condivisa di Windows con il comando mount

30 Dicembre 2007

Se non lo avete fatto in precedenza, installate il pacchetto smbfs:

sudo apt-get install smbfs

Create in /mnt una cartella con il nome del pc o della condivisione alla quale connettersi. Nell’esempio creeremo una cartella di nome punto_di_mount:

sudo mkdir /mnt/punto_di_mount

Si presume che si abbiano delle valide credenziali di accesso al sistema Windows.

Adesso montiamo una ipotetica cartella condivisa di Windows chiamata cartella_condivisa:

sudo mount -t smbfs -o username=username_valida //nome_pc_win/nome_condivisione /mnt/punto_di_mount

Leggi il seguito di questo post »


Installare e configurare Samba

30 Dicembre 2007

Per installare Samba eseguire il comando:

sudo apt-get install samba

Io vi consiglio di installare anche altri 2 pacchetti relativi a samba, che vedremo in seguito:

sudo apt-get install samba smbfs samba-client

Il file di configurazione è tipicamente situato nella directory /etc/samba/smb.conf

Prima di metterci le mani è buona norma, come per tutti i file di configurazione, farne una copia di backup, usando il comando:

cp -p /etc/samba/smb.conf /etc/samba/smb.conf.originale

L’opzione -p indica di mantenere inalterati gli attributi del file (data, permessi, proprietari, ecc.)

Un modello di configurazione funzionante del file smb.conf è il seguente:

Leggi il seguito di questo post »


Montare un Hard Disk collegato alla porta USB2 dell’NSLU2

30 Dicembre 2007

L’hard disk (nel caso ci sia un’unica partizione) verrà riconosciuto come sdb1 in /dev/sdb1

Per montare un hard disk collegato alla porta USB2:

mount /dev/sdb1 /media/punto_di_mount

Dove punto_di_mount è il nome che volete assegnare all’unità. Accertarsi di aver prima creato la cartella /media/punto_di_mount

Per smontare l’hard disk dovete usare il comando:

umount /dev/sdb1

oppure:

umount /media/punto_di_mount

Per fare in modo che l’hard disk venga montato automaticamente all’avvio dell’NSLU2 dobbiamo modificare il file /etc/fstab:

Leggi il seguito di questo post »


Cambiare la funzione del tasto Power in NSLU2 Debian

29 Dicembre 2007

Prima di installare il firmware Debian sull’NSLU2, tale tasto aveva la funzione di accensione e spegnimento dell’apparecchio.

Una volta installato Debian, il tasto Power perde la sua funzione originaria e prende la funzione di tasto Reset.

Dato che l’NSLU2 si può riavviare tranquillamente tramite shell/ssh con il comando:

reboot

torna utile ripristinare la funzione originaria di tasto Power vero e proprio.

Leggi il seguito di questo post »